[ANN] Apache Tomcat 7.0.35 released
The Apache Tomcat team announces the immediate availability of Apache
Tomcat 7.0.35.
Apache Tomcat is an open source software implementation of the Java
Servlet and JavaServer Pages technologies.
This release contains a small number of bug fixes and improvements
compared to version 7.0.34. The notable changes include:
- Integrate documentation of Tomcat 7 with Apache Comments System.
People can leave their comments when reading the documentation online.
- Improve detection of JAVA_HOME on OSX.
- Add support for auto-detection and configuration of JARs on the
classpath that provide tag plug-in implementations. Based on a patch
by Sheldon Shao.
Please refer to the change log for the complete list of changes:
http://tomcat.apache.org/tomcat-7.0-doc/changelog.html
Note: This version has 4 zip binaries: a generic one and three
bundled with Tomcat native binaries for Windows operating systems
running on different CPU architectures.
Note: If you use the APR/native AJP or HTTP connector you *must* upgrade
to version 1.1.24 or later of the AJP/native library
